#### When to Visit Asakusa\n
  • Hottest months: August, July, September and June, with an average temperature of 25°C
  • Coldest months: January, February, December and March
  • Driest months: January, December, February and November
  • Rainiest months: October, September, June and July
What's there to see and do in Asakusa?
Enjoy Asakusa with a stop at Sensoji Temple, Asakusa Shrine and Hanayashiki Amusement Park. If you have a little extra time during your trip, you might want to make a stop at Hoppy Street and Nakamise Street.
